Leaf Clean-Up

Jordan Jordan November 8, 2013 3 Comments

6772696059_2450de4ffc_zColleen Kurke of the Wallingford Chamber writes:

A Fall Clean up will be underway this Saturday at 2pm. We will meet at CUTZ (4515 Meridian Ave N), then go from there. Hallows Church will be offering their services towards this endeavor but all are welcome to help . We need bags and rakes in case someone wants to donate. The rakes will be returned.
